RABAT, Dec. 28 - Nearly 13.7 percent of the Moroccan population currently live below poverty line with less than 3,500 Dhs (around US $388) per year, revealed the Moroccan Social Development, Family and Solidarity Minister.

Abderrahim Harouchi noted in an interview published Tuesday in "Le Matin du Sahara et du Maghreb” daily that social exclusion affects thousands of people living in shanty towns and unhealthy housing zones.

According to the Minister, illiteracy, which he deemed a factor of exclusion, touches 44pc of the Moroccan overall population that is estimated at over 29 millions.

Fighting poverty in rural areas, he said, requires an “integrated development program including literacy programs, training, revenue-generating activities and support to the local development process.

Harouchi also evoked in the interview the problem of “professional” beggars, who “use rented or stolen children” in their activities.

“We cannot turn a blind eye to such mistreatments,” he said, highlighting the role of citizens in dissuasion.

He noted that his department has signed conventions with 36 associations in Casablanca and Rabat to create revenue-generating activities to help these beggars.

Last November, Harouchi said a budget of 20 million DH (over US$ 2 million) was earmarked for a program to control beggary and the use of children in begging.
